PineBridge Investments is seeking an Associate or Vice President, Client Relations is responsible for managing and expanding relationships with corporate and public sector institutional clients, including corporate pension plans, endowments, foundations, sovereign entities, and public pension funds. The role focuses on delivering exceptional client service, supporting asset retention and growth, and acting as a key liaison between clients and internal investment, product, and operational teams.

This role will serve as an ambassador and client advocate overseeing full client life cycle, client needs & mandate expansion opportunities. This role will touch all asset classes and requires a solid understanding of the asset management business given the added complexities of supporting institutional clients. The individual will possess a solid knowledge across asset classes (e.g., public fixed income, equities, private markets, multi-asset) and across investment vehicles (e.g., mutual funds, SMA).

The Associate or Vice President, Client Relations reports directly to the head of Americas Client Relations with a functional reporting line into the Head of Institutional Sales, Americas.

What you need to know about the Seattle Tech Scene

Home to tech titans like Microsoft and Amazon, Seattle punches far above its weight in innovation. But its surrounding mountains, sprinkled with world-famous hiking trails and climbing routes, make the city a destination for outdoorsy types as well. Established as a logging town before shifting to shipbuilding and logistics, the Emerald City is now known for its contributions to aerospace, software, biotech and cloud computing. And its status as a thriving tech ecosystem is attracting out-of-town companies looking to establish new tech and engineering hubs.

Key Facts About Seattle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 287,000; 13%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Amazon, Microsoft, Meta,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, software, biotechnology,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Madrona, Fuse, Tola, Maveron
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Washington, Seattle University, Seattle Pacific University, Allen Institute for Brain Science,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Seattle Children’s Research Institute
